vnclub配置管理工具使用介绍

vnclub配置管理工具使用介绍

ID:38578533

大小:1.25 MB

页数:67页

时间:2019-06-15

vnclub配置管理工具使用介绍_第1页
vnclub配置管理工具使用介绍_第2页
vnclub配置管理工具使用介绍_第3页
vnclub配置管理工具使用介绍_第4页
vnclub配置管理工具使用介绍_第5页
资源描述:

《vnclub配置管理工具使用介绍》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、软件配置管理及其工具使用介绍9/9/20211软件配置管理及其工具使用介绍什么是软件配置管理Subversion的介绍及基本操作Trac的介绍及基本操作Trac与Subversion整合Eclipse中mylyn插件的安装过程9/9/20212什么是软件配置管理没有软件配置管理会出现什么?由于开发经费及开发时间的限制,不可能一次解决所有的问题,许多问题都待维护阶段解决,因此带来的是软件产品的不断升级,而维护和升级所必须的文档往往非常混乱开发过程中缺乏规范化的管理,即使有源程序文档也由于说明不详细而不能对产品的功能有深刻的认识,导致大量的人力,物力和时间去分析

2、源程序在软件的团队开发中,人员流动在所难免,如果管理不善,有些人员的流动将对开发产生致命的影响,特别是软件开发管理人员或核心成员的流失,有可能造成无法确定软件产品中各模块所处的状态和阶段,使软件产品的版本出现混乱,甚至泄露公司的核心机密管理不善致使没经过测试的代码加入到了产品中,不但影响了产品的质量,有时还会导致致命的错误,造成不可挽回的损失9/9/20213什么是软件配置管理什么是软件配置管理?仓库还是超市?9/9/20214版本库的标准版本库采用一个项目对应一个版本库的形式存放在配置管理服务器上;9/9/20215版本库标准-子项目版本库采用一个项目对应

3、一个版本库的形式存放在配置管理服务器上;9/9/20216Page7TagBranchesTrunkProject1RootProject2TagBranchesTrunkCodeDoc源代码文档主干:开发主线标签:存放各里程碑的快照(标签永久保存,文件不可修改)分支:并行开发,如缺陷修复Subversion的版本库模板Tools数据库相关文件脚本等9/9/20217阶段目的对软件开发过程中的程序代码、文档等配置项进行明确的、量化的管理;配置管理工作贯穿于软件开发活动的始终,覆盖了开发活动的各个环节;全面的保存、管理各个配置项,监控各个配置项的状态,并向项目

4、经理及相关人员报告,从而实现对软件过程状态的控制;9/9/20218Subversion的介绍及基本操作Subversion的介绍Subversion的修订版本号Subversion的访问方式Subversion的客户端工具使用TortoiseSVN初次操作典型的操作流程典型的工作流程9/9/20219Subversion的介绍代码文档统一存放目录控制历史可回溯原子化提交通过标签建立基线通过分支支持并行开发9/9/202110Subversion的修订版本号01239/9/202111Subversion的访问方式http://配置Subversion的Ap

5、ache服务器的WebDAV协议9/9/202112Subversion的客户端工具命令行工具svn:基本svn命令svnadmin:存储库管理TortoiseSVN工具与windows资源管理器集成。推荐使用下面版本的SVN客户端TrtoiseSVN-1.6.10.19898-win32-svn-1.6.12.msi插件Subclipse(适合Eclipse)9/9/202113使用TortoiseSVN初次操作安装TortoiseSVN,安装后重启系统申请svn账户建立本地副本目录,准备检出沙箱操作(用户首次使用的试验)9/9/202114典型的操作流程

6、检出(Checkout、Update)添加、删除、移动/更名(Add、Detete、Move/Rename)查看变动(Status)提交(Commit)“反悔”(Revert)比较差异(Diff)打标签(Tagging)9/9/202115Page16svncheckout获得内容svnaddsvnmovesvndeletesvnrename修改svnstatus-u看看我在本地都修改了哪些?svnupdate更新本地工作副本(workingcopy)svndiffsvnresolved合并(Merge)你的修改 解决冲突svncommit提交你的修改105

7、100106Subversion版本库典型的工作流程9/9/202116Page17在空目录下,右键SVNCheckout填写URL用TortoiseSVN检出(CheckOut)9/9/202117用TortoiseSVN检出(CheckOut)填写“Authentication”用户信息OK9/9/202118Page19StatusnormalAddedfile/directoryModified用TortoiseSVN查看变动(Status)Conflicts9/9/202119Page20切换到希望更新的项目目录,右键Update填写“A

8、uthentication”用户信息OK用Tort

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。